Jade Cargill is days away from officially starting her WWE run.
After a successful AEW tenure, she signed with WWE last year and trained for the past several months at the Performance Center. She previously made appearances on Raw, NXT, and SmackDown in backstage segments.
Cargill made her in-ring WWE debut when she worked the Women’s Royal Rumble Match. She entered the match as the #28 entrant and teased a showdown with Bianca Belair before being eliminated.
Since then, she has been appearing on TV, teasing which brand she would sign with. That ended up being SmackDown. Her first appearance as a member of the brand will be this Friday on SmackDown.
While at the Portland Trailblazers vs. Atlanta Hawks game, she gave a brief statement to Sammy_Socialite on X, sending a message to fans ahead of SmackDown.
“Just keep watching. I need y’all to watch this Friday. Some big sh*t is about to happen. We [are] making money around here, you feel me?”
